Garmin Reports Record Results and Forecasts 2026 Above Estimates

Shares rose on a forecast topping Wall Street estimates.

Overview

  • Fourth-quarter revenue reached $2.12 billion, up 17%, with operating margin at 28.9%, operating income of $614 million, GAAP EPS of $2.73 and pro forma EPS of $2.79.
  • Full-year 2025 revenue hit a record $7.25 billion with more than 20 million units shipped and operating margin expanding to 25.9%.
  • For 2026, the company guided to about $7.9 billion in revenue and adjusted earnings of $9.35 per share, both above LSEG-tracked consensus reported by Reuters.
  • Fitness led the quarter as segment revenue rose 42% to roughly $766 million on demand for Venu 4 and Bounce 2, with marine and aviation also delivering double-digit growth.
  • Financial outlets reported a proposed 17% increase in the annual dividend to $4.20 and a $500 million share repurchase authorization, as Garmin also highlighted new GPSMAP 9000xsv chartplotters, AI-powered nutrition features in Garmin Connect+, a Truemed HSA/FSA option and five CES 2026 awards.
